My hands are tied
Void of the ability to fix what is broken in you.
I know the pain, it's all too familiar
I'd hoped one day we could mend one another
You know what's within you
I wonder if it's within us all.
Would you acknowledge the strength you possess,
The one you never mention, but shy from when I point it out?
I'm convinced we can't help ourselves
But I know I'd do what it takes to help you.
You're a prisoner in a cage built by you,
Built by everything that haunts you,
Built by everything and nothing that you let in.
I barely know what consumes you.
You show me what you can,
What you're not afraid to show me.
I take what I can get but I'd rather have it all.
I'm here for you,
I'll listen unwaveringly.
If I've ever made you doubt the sincerity of these things,
I'm deeply sorry.
